Output 34be3b899625aa316d0bd49a984a83b4159a9f452aec7b0afbf1d4fb9adb32b2:43

value
40998
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 56a4d6665d6fdba77f4831a72885b56986e93569 OP_EQUALVERIFY OP_CHECKSIG
address
18u8acFBpyTgAFw3FaisjQvui6FcZ1FN37
transaction
34be3b899625aa316d0bd49a984a83b4159a9f452aec7b0afbf1d4fb9adb32b2
spent
true